  • Why don’t you like yourself? Gabby Bernstein: How to stop numbing difficult emotions
    2025/08/18

    Getting lost in anxiety, shame, or self-loathing? Spiritual leader Gabby Bernstein wants you to acknowledge all the messy parts of your true character. Spoiler: you’re not going suddenly to like yourself overnight, but acknowledging the uncomfortable bits will get you there sooner!


    In this chat with Fearne, Gabby explains how ‘protector parts’ like perfectionism, people pleasing, and numbing out can spiral into extreme self-soothing behaviours like drug or porn addiction if they’re not dealt with.


    Fearne and Gabby chat about anxiety as a protection mechanism, exploring why being focused on the heart palpitations and hyper-vigilance is stopping you dealing with your deeper wounds.


    Plus, Fearne notices that her OCD is back so Gabby takes a moment to help her check in with her current stress levels – you can follow along with this exercise too!


    Gabby’s latest book, Self-Help, is out now.

  • Book Club Meets: I’m obsessed with romance scams! Gaslighting and misogyny, with Lisa Jewell
    2025/08/11

    Do you love a true crime scam documentary? Our latest Happy Place Book Club read is for you! Iconic author Lisa Jewell has written Don’t Let Him In, a thriller about a perfect man... who’s a fraudulent liar.


    In this chat with Fearne, live from The Happy Place Festival, Lisa explains how she got into the mind of a psychopath despite being a very honest person herself. They explore how people fall for charming romance scammers, and how Lisa has become a relentlessly happy person.


    Plus, Lisa’s written 24 novels but has given up on trying to be a ‘professional’ kind of person – she explains how to sod the rules and build confidence in your own process.
